doom
B2
noun
사용법:
70%
fate, destiny
번역: fate, destiny
발음: /duːm/
뜻: A terrible fate or destiny, especially one that is unavoidable and causes ruin or death.

Doom means a very bad fate or future. It is often used to talk about something bad that will happen and cannot be stopped. People use doom when they feel something will end badly.

He faced his doom without fear.

The old ship met its doom at sea.

2
C1
noun
사용법:
45%
judgment, sentence
번역: judgment, sentence
발음: /duːm/
뜻: Judgment, especially the final judgment of souls in religious belief or afterlife.

Doom can mean a religious idea about being judged after death. It is the idea that souls will be decided for heaven or hell. This meaning is often seen in stories and religion.

He feared the doom after death.

The story spoke of doom and judgment.

3
B2
verb
사용법:
65%
condemn, sentence
번역: condemn, sentence
발음: /duːm/
뜻: To decide or condemn someone to a bad fate or punishment.

To doom someone means to give them a bad future or punishment. It is like saying they cannot avoid a bad thing. For example, a judge can doom a person to prison.

The court doomed him to prison.

She doomed the plan to fail.

5
C2
noun
사용법:
10%
law, judgment
번역: law, judgment
발음: /duːm/
뜻: An old legal term for a law, judgment, or an official decision.

Historically, doom meant a formal law or decision by a ruler or court. This meaning is old and used mostly in historical texts or stories.

The king issued a doom for the land.

This doom was read aloud at court.

7
B2
noun
사용법:
65%
destruction, end
번역: destruction, end
발음: /duːm/
뜻: The end or destruction of something, often on a very large scale.

Doom can mean the end or destruction of a place or thing. It often means something bad stopping existence or life.

The city faced its doom in the fire.

War brought doom to the country.
